46 sneaker

 

Returning from the interior near Belém with a small sheet of borracha defumada (1) Dom Lobo believed he had solved an all-consuming problem. Slippers (2) soled with this material would let the king pilfer pastries in the dead of night without a sound.

 

Unfortunately, in Rio’s heat the rubber softened and adhered to every surface it touched. Lobo advised delay. 

 

João, eager for stealthy snacking, commanded "Apenas faça” (Just do it) but immediately regretted it.

 

1 Borracha defumada, made using indigenous smoke-curing methods, yielded a brown, leathery material, more durable than air-dried latex.
2 The slippers bore João’s stylized J monogram, later the basis for an unsuccessful lawsuit against a well-known maker of athletic equipment.
